Herbal Remedies in Historical Context

Throughout history, herbal remedies have been an integral part of healing practices in various cultures, offering natural solutions for managing stress and anxiety. While these remedies have their roots in ancient traditions, they continue to resonate today as part of a holistic approach to health.

Herbal Remedy Culture Purpose
Chamomile Ancient Egypt Calming effects
Valerian Root Ancient Greece Sleep aid and relaxation
Ashwagandha Traditional India Stress reduction

These ancient practices highlight a deep understanding of nature’s ability to support our well-being. People utilized these herbs not only to address physical issues but also to promote mental tranquility. Stoicism and Resilience

Understanding the principles of Stoicism can greatly enhance your approach to managing stress and promoting resilience, particularly when it comes to your overall wellness. By focusing on what you can control and letting go of what you can’t, you can find relief from anxiety and improve your mental health.

Here are three key Stoic practices that can complement your journey towards optimal health, especially when combined with chiropractic care:

1. Negative Visualization: By imagining potential challenges or setbacks, you prepare yourself emotionally. This practice helps to reduce the shock or stress when facing difficulties, making it easier to maintain a calm and balanced state.
